Output 6d12a7bc457c977cda2a4003a115dd3bda1f3ccfa02a28aea30d3b596689e6c3:3

value
1966988
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d84426d723882e45e8058f21ec903f70c99232d0 OP_EQUAL
address
3MQXXF5wB996HymZ5WzNMdjzWVBkXzyWTR
transaction
6d12a7bc457c977cda2a4003a115dd3bda1f3ccfa02a28aea30d3b596689e6c3
confirmations
386862
spent
true